| HOLE
COTTAGE
Markbeech, Kent
This is the cross-wing of a late medieval
timber framed hall-house, of high quality, the rest of which
was pulled down in 1833. It lies by a small stream in a woodland
clearing and, curiously enough, is easily accessible by railway,
since it is only a 15 minute walk through the wood from Cowden
station.
The Hole still has the true feeling of the
Weald and of the deep woods in whose drop and shade the forges
and furnaces of the Sussex ironmasters were established. This
despite the great storm of October 1987.
